Guidestar is a website to help users find information about nonprofit organizations.  Basically Guidestar gathers and disseminates information about IRS registered nonprofit organizations.

It provides information about each organizations mission, legitimacy, impact, reputation, finance, programs, transparency, governance and more.  To learn even more about Guidestar click on this link with is their 'About Us' page.

Guidestar has a search box at the top of the page - in addition users can click on boxes at the top left side of the page on Geography, Organization and Financials for additional links.  Users can also type in the state, zip code and other geographical information to find a nonprofit organization. 

When a nonprofit organization of interest is found, users can find the organizations' mission statement, ruling year (year the IRS granted the organization tax exempt status), President/CEO, contact information, EIN and keywords related to the nonprofit.

Users are allowed 5 free profiles before they are 'locked' out of the site.  However, by creating yor own free account, users can unlock unlimited profile views!

Links to Programs can be found at the top of the page.  In addition, Financials can be found at the other link at the top of the page as well. Operational information is available as well. However, to find this information (Program, Financial, Operational information) users will need to create a free account on the site....

Just found a very interesting news website. Its not like a traditional newspaper site like the New York Times or Newsday or the Washington Post though.

The site name is Paperboy and bills itself as letting readers being able to 'Choose From Our List of 12092 Online Newspapers and ePapers to Get Your Daily Newspaper Fix!'  That is pretty darn awesome!  Try subscribing to 2 newspapers, let alone a dozen or so.

Anyway, there is a search box at the top right side of the webpage where users can click on a dialog box to be able to search for a particular newspaper or to do a Google webs search or to search for news headlines.  Simple and straightforward.

A visit to the site lists the top 25 newspapers listed by circulation. The names of the newspapers - and links are included in the first section of the page. 

Further down the page is a link to the Top 100 US Newspapers and US Newspapers Listed by State.  Even further down on the page is a list of World Newspapers Listed By Country.

There are links to World Newspapers, US Newspapers, News Headlines and Front Pages at the top of the sites' homepage.

One of the better reference related websites available on the internet is Refdesk.com.  The site is eclectic - it has something for everyone as this blog post will attest to.

Refdesk has many, many useful features for users including options to check your email from a central location, a debt clock, Contacting Elected Officials, Job Search Resources, USA Gas Price Map, Headline News from Bing, Google, and Yahoo.  There is also a way to select a news source from either AP, BBC, Bing, Fox, Google, NPR, UPI, WSJ,  or Yahoo!


Users can search Yahoo! or YouTube from the homepage and also look for the Fact of the Day or Though of the Day or This Day in History.

Users can actually search Refdesk.com - use the search box on the left side of the page.  Users can also use TheFreeDictionary.com as a computing dictionary, medical dictionary, legal dictionary, financial dictionary or an acronym finder.

There are also People White Page Resources available to users.  For example, users can search 50States.com, AnyWho.com, Intelius.com, WhitePages.com.  There are also Reverse Phone Lookup sites and Reverse Address Lookup sites....sigh. 

And, finally, there are good news sites like Amazing News, Gallup Well-Being Index, Good News Broadcast,  and HappyNews.com.

What I just mentioned are just 'some' of the link from the top half of the homepage on RefDesk.com.  When I say that the site is eclectic and chock full of links, I am not kidding.

One last note...toward the middle of the page are various links under the rubric 'Today's Pictures'.  Trust me - this is awesome.  Link under this category are as varied as Botany Picture of the Day, Earth Images, Kodak, Latest Mars Images, National Geographic Photos in the News, Reuters Pictures, Top News Photos, Weather Photo Gallery and Webcam Index.
